[LoopIdiom] 'left-shift-until-bittest': keep no-wrap flags on shift, fix edge-case miscompilation for %x.next While `%x.curr` is always safe to compute, because `LoopBackedgeTakenCount` will always be smaller than `bitwidth(X)`, i.e. we never get poison, rewriting `%x.next` is more complicated, however, because `X << LoopTripCount` will be poison iff `LoopTripCount == bitwidth(X)` (which will happen iff `BitPos` is `bitwidth(x) - 1` and `X` is `1`). So unless we know that isn't the case (as alive2 notes, we know it's safe to do iff shift had no-wrap flags, or bitpos does not indicate signbit, or we know that %x is never `1`), we'll need to emit an alternative, safe IR, by either just shifting the `%x.curr`, or conditionally selecting between the computed `%x.next` and `0`.. Former IR looks better so let's do that. While there, ensure that we don't drop no-wrap flags from said shift.
